Summary/Abstract: In recent years, education in Bulgaria has followed the trends imposed by the European Union and related to the mastery of some key competences. They contribute to the development of knowledge, skills and attitudes in students, as well as to their more successful social fulfilment. Since 2016/2017 school year, education in Bulgarian schools has been in compliance with the new Pre-School and Primary School Education Act. Pursuant to this act, students are to be educated according to new curricula and learning kits for the respective year of education. According to the new curricula, the general education of students from 1 to 4 grade, covers main groups of key competences. With the direction and goals of modern mathematics education towards development of competencies, the role of word problems, which are mostly related to modelling and solving practical problems by students, is increasing. It is essential to check whether, while educating primary school students in Bulgaria, due attention is paid to word problems and the skills for solving them. Are there relatively large number of problems of various types and semantics included in the available mathematics textbooks for third-year students? Learning how to solve word problems in primary schools is an integral part of studying mathematics. Word problems take a significant part of the learning content in Mathematics for primary school students. They reveal to students the connection between theory and practice, as well as the application of Mathematics in people‟s daily lives. Students solve word problems containing indirect relations from their third school year. Indirect word problems are a challenge for primary school students. They are introduced in pairs – students are presented with a direct and an indirect problem. The students compare and analyse them and come to the conclusion that their solution is the same. The main idea of this article is to provide an analysis of the indirect problems included in five of the new textbooks and notebooks in Mathematics for third-year students. The purpose is to establish the number of the indirect plot word problems compared to the total number of plot word problems, intended for class work with primary school students. Since 2019/2020 school year, the Ministry of Education and Science has included indirect word problems in the annual assessment of the educational results of students at the end of their fourth year, carried out as a national external assessment. This is the school year in which the first fourth-year students completed their initial stage of education according to the new act, the new curricula and learning kits. That is why it is interesting to me how this teaching content is included in the new Mathematics learning kits and whether students will be prepared for the new format of the national external assessment.
